Endeavour to declare maiden Kari West resource estimate in the fourth quarter

2nd July 2019 By: Marleny Arnoldi - Deputy Editor Online

TSX-listed Endeavour Mining anticipates to declare a maiden resource estimate at its Kari West deposit during the fourth quarter, while Kari Center discoveries are expected to be announced around the same time.

The company has drilled more than 104 000 m over the Kari gold-in-soil anomaly since late 2018, totalling around 300 000 m of drilling since 2017.

The Kari discoveries form part of the Houndé mine, in Burkina Faso.

About 85% of the holes encountered in the drill programme to date have shown meaningful mineralisation.

Kari West now extends over an area that is 1 000 m long and 500 m wide and remains open at depth and to the east towards the Kari Pump deposit.

Kari Pump’s near-surface mineralisation, in turn, has been extended 700 m to the northeast and 900 m towards Kari West and remains open.

The Kari Center deposit now comprises two mineralised zones; one zone extends 1 300 m along strike and is 300 m wide, and remains open at depth and to the east towards Kari Pump; a newly discovered zone extends 2 100 m along strike and across a width of more than 400 m, remaining open at depth and to the south.
